Understanding Verizon Locked Phones
A Verizon locked phone is restricted to Verizon’s network, meaning it cannot be used with other carriers without unlocking. This restriction can influence the selling process, as some buyers prefer unlocked devices for flexibility. Knowing the specifics of your device helps you choose the best selling method.
Advantages of Selling Online
- Wider Audience: Online platforms reach buyers nationwide or even internationally.
- Convenience: Sell from home without meeting in person.
- Price Comparison: Easily compare offers from different buyers or platforms.
- Speed: Listings can attract buyers quickly with proper marketing.
Disadvantages of Selling Online
- Scams: Risk of fraudulent buyers or scams if not careful.
- Shipping Costs: May need to ship the device, adding costs and risks.
- Time: Negotiations and shipping can take time.
- Fees: Some platforms charge listing or selling fees.
Advantages of Selling Locally
- Immediate Payment: Usually get cash on the spot.
- Personal Interaction: Can inspect the device and verify payment directly.
- No Shipping: Avoid shipping costs or risks of loss.
- Privacy: Keep personal details limited compared to online listings.
Disadvantages of Selling Locally
- Limited Audience: Only reach local buyers.
- Time-Consuming: Meeting buyers can take time and effort.
- Safety Risks: Meeting strangers might pose safety concerns.
- Price Negotiation: May have less room for negotiation compared to online offers.
Tips for Selling Your Verizon Locked Phone
Whether selling online or locally, follow these tips to maximize your sale:
- Unlock Your Phone: If possible, unlock your device to increase its value.
- Clean and Reset: Remove personal data and restore factory settings.
- Accurate Description: Provide clear details about the phone’s condition and specifications.
- Research Prices: Check current market prices for similar devices.
- Secure Payment: Use trusted payment methods, especially online.
- Meet in Safe Locations: If selling locally, choose public places for meetings.
